How to enable Apple Intelligence on Mac
To enable Apple Intelligence on Mac, you must have a Mac with an M1 chip. Plus, it must be updated to macOS Sequoia 15.1.
You can do this by going to System Settings (via Apple icon on the top-right corner) > Software Update. In the "Available Updates" section, check for macOS Sequoia 15.1 and click on "Restart now."

This update will take about 20 minutes to install.

Next, you can enable Apple Intelligence by, once again, navigating to System Settingsand clicking on "Apple Intelligence & Siri."Next, click on"Turn on Apple Intelligence"and follow the prompts.
Apple Intelligence features you can use on Mac
Now that you have Apple Intelligence turned on, you may be wondering which Apple Intelligence features you can use on your Mac. AI-powered perks include the following:
Writing assistance for adjusting your tone
Summarized notifications of your emails, texts, and more
A more conversational Siri
Webpage summaries
Natural language support for searching within the Photos app
Transcripts of audio recordings
To get started with Apple Intelligence, head over to Notes or Messages, type some text, and right click it, allowing you to receive some options on how to adjust the tone to your liking (i.e., friendly or professional). Plus, there's also a new Type-to-Siri feature that you can access by double-pressing the COMMAND key.
